How they compare
Bahrain currently reports 3.3 against 3.3 in Spain, a difference of 0.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 39 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Spain ahead.
Bahrain ranks 93rd and Spain ranks 93rd of 188 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Bahrain averaged higher in 2 and Spain in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bahrain | Spain |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 3.9 | 4.18 | 0.28 | Spain |
| 1990s | 3.87 | 3.92 | 0.05 | Spain |
| 2000s | 3.7 | 3.68 | 0.02 | Bahrain |
| 2010s | 3.43 | 3.41 | 0.0222 | Bahrain |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
